| Prayer for Protection against the Wicked. For the Chief Musician. A Psalm of David.
 |  | 
|  |  | 
| 1 Deliver me, O Jehovah, from the evil man; Preserve me from the violent man:
 
 |  | 
| 2 Who devise mischiefs in their heart; Continually do they gather themselves together for war.
 
 |  | 
| 3 They have sharpened their tongue like a serpent; Adders’ poison is under their lips. {Selah
 
 |  | 
| 4 Keep me, O Jehovah, from the hands of the wicked; Preserve me from the violent man:
 Who have purposed to thrust aside my steps.
 
 |  | 
| 5 The proud have hid a snare for me, and cords; They have spread a net by the wayside;
 They have set gins for me. {Selah
 
 |  | 
| 6 I said unto Jehovah, Thou art my God: Give ear unto the voice of my supplications, O Jehovah.
 
 |  | 
| 7 O Jehovah the Lord, the strength of my salvation, Thou hast covered my head in the day of battle.
 
 |  | 
| 8 Grant not, O Jehovah, the desires of the wicked; Further not his evil device, lest they exalt themselves. {Selah
 
 |  | 
| 9 As for the head of those that compass me about, Let the mischief of their own lips cover them.
 
 |  | 
| 10 Let burning coals fall upon them: Let them be cast into the fire,
 Into deep pits, whence they shall not rise.
 
 |  | 
| 11 An evil speaker shall not be established in the earth: Evil shall hunt the violent man to overthrow him.
 
 |  | 
| 12 I know that Jehovah will maintain the cause of the afflicted, And justice for the needy.
 
 |  | 
| 13 Surely the righteous shall give thanks unto thy name: The upright shall dwell in thy presence.
